Output 60cf76e1672d5303095b0c32bcde1a5953ea4fb5f32dc522613a36a94a517c47:29

value
2050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5911e93030d288ce667ea021f0d3ad661e719881 OP_EQUAL
address
39oyX61gMtQp4StEWMbPocavHmoxVB4M6q
transaction
60cf76e1672d5303095b0c32bcde1a5953ea4fb5f32dc522613a36a94a517c47
spent
true